Derek stumbled into the kitchen, reading the clock on the stove. It was two in the morning and he was at home on a Friday night rather than at a party. Definitely not how he pictured his first week at University. He blamed Tina and Stacey. How was he supposed to know the two knew eachother? Or that they were twins? They looked nothing alike! Still, badmouthing him to the whole dorm was a bit much. He’d give it a week for everyone to forget. A groan from the other end of the kitchen startled him from his thoughts. Squinting in the dark, he made out a small form on the ground.
“Casey?”
He turned on the kitchen light and Casey threw her hands in front of her face.
“Nooooo.”
Well, that’s what he thought the garbled response must have meant.
He turned off the light and sat down next to her, the nightlight in the foyer casting a soft orange glow over her.
“Are you just getting back? Now?”
“Yeah.”
Okay that was English, that was a good sign. Derek sighed.
“Great, Casey has plans on a Friday night and I don’t.”
“Tina—”
“I don’t need a play by play, I was there,” he replied bitterly. Casey scooted closer, till her head was resting on his thigh. His whole body seized.
“Hey Godzilla, I don’t want your—”
A light snore interrupted him. Still frozen, he took a moment to study her. Her hair was splayed over his lap, she’d curled against the warmth of his thigh. She was wearing pink gloss on her lips. And some other stuff, but it was hard to look away when she used that gloss. He lightly pushed her hair from her forehead.
“Never mind,” he said, softly.
She was still wearing her dress, but managed to take her shoes off. A small, tight dress that was now caressing every inch of her in ways he’d never admit he’d thought about. He looked away quickly and scrambled to take off his own hoodie and draped it over her. She responded by pulling it tighter against her body.
She’d gone out to the dorm mixer, which only newbies went to. Derek wouldn’t have been caught dead at those things. Which made it a perfect place for Casey. He was surprised she had even gotten drunk.
A darker thought hit him. She’d been unresponsive when she got him. Had someone tampered with her drink? Damn, he should have gone with her! She definitely smelled like beer. He looked frantically and found her phone under her arm. He used her fingerprint to unlock it. There was a message from someone named Vanessa.
So much fun meeting you Casey! I put your keys on your front desk when I brought you home. Text me to tomorrow so I know you’re alive after those two beers!
Derek’s shoulders relaxed. The lightweight had just gotten drunk for the first time. He tried to ignore the way his heart beat loudly and painfully at the thought of anything happening to Casey.
He looked down at her sleeping form. She smiled in her sleep, and his heart leapt into his throat. With a trembling hand he caressed her cheek lightly.
“I’m fucked, aren’t I?” He whispered.

I'm still thinking about Casey's husband because there's such a gold mine there...
No one looks surprised he didn't even raise an eyebrow when the kids went missing and got arrested or when Sky and Luca were missing and came back with Sky broken and Luca feeling awful. No one bats an eyelash at the fact that a guy that supposedly values his family more than anything didn't even text Casey.
Luca admits that he doesn't see his dad for half of the year and he's jealous that Sky gets to spend every day with hers, and the other kids don't even really bother to mention Peter. They're 7 and 8, ages where stories of parental woes and dads being dumb are a critical part of morning meetings on school days.
Casey is one step away from a nervous breakdown and at no point did anyone think to call her husband; no, instead, it was pure coincidence that had Derek come.
It seemed like George and Nora were barely aware Casey had a husband; they were calm and collected and obviously happy with the fact that Derek and Casey were getting along.
It's inferred that Derek plays hockey in college. Did Casey start going out with Peter to spite him? There has to be a story there; Derek hates it when his friends are into her.
Probably the most upsetting point of this whole thing is that Casey is running herself ragged because she thinks it's what marriage and such are supposed to be like and Derek can't even save her from herself because she won't talk about it.
